What Size Soccer Ball is Best by Age?

A size 5 ball, which is the regulation size for adult matches, may be too heavy and difficult for younger children to control. As a general rule, size 3 balls are best for players under 8 years old, size 4 for ages 8-12, and size 5 for ages 12 and up. By selecting the appropriate size, you can ensure that your child is able to play the game safely and have the most fun possible.

Size 1 Soccer Ball

Introducing the perfect soccer ball for your youngest soccer enthusiast: the size 1 soccer ball. Measuring between 18 and 20 inches in circumference, this mini ball is perfect for children aged three and under. Despite its small size, it’s still the perfect size for small hands to grip and kick around. Not only is it small and manageable, but it’s also lightweight, making it easy for your little one to maneuver and play with. Size 2 Soccer Ball

Soccer is a game that many kids love to play, and getting them started at a young age can be so exciting! If you’re looking for a soccer ball that’s perfect for your little one, you might consider a size 2 ball. Designed specifically for children ages 3-5, these balls are just the right size for tiny hands to grip and feet to kick. At 20-22 inches in circumference and weighing in at 250-280 grams, your child will feel confident and comfortable on the field. Size 3 Soccer Ball

Introducing the perfect soccer ball for your little athlete – size 3! Designed specifically for kids between 5 and 8 years old, this ball boasts a smaller circumference of 23 to 24 inches, making it easier for small hands to grip and control. Weighing in at just 300 to 320 grams, children won’t be weighed down as they kick and dribble with ease. Whether they’re playing with friends or practicing drills with their team, this lightweight ball is the ideal choice for young players who are just starting out. Size 4 Soccer Ball

When it comes to playing soccer, the size of the ball matters. For kids between the ages of 8 and 12, a size 4 soccer ball is recommended for optimal training and gameplay. At a circumference of 25-26 inches and weighing around 350-390 grams, this size offers just the right balance between control and power for young players. It’s important to note that using the right size ball can improve a child’s performance and help prevent injuries, so sticking to these specifications is crucial. Size 5 Soccer Ball

Size 5 soccer balls are the most commonly used ball in professional and amateur soccer leagues and championships. These balls are designed for players aged 12 years and older and have a circumference between 27 and 28 inches, with a weight ranging from 410 to 450 grams. The size 5 ball is preferred due to its larger size and weight, which allows for more control and accuracy when passing, dribbling, and shooting. How to Test a Soccer Ball’s Size and Weight Before Buying It

First, make sure you’re familiar with the regulations set by the governing body of the competition you’ll be playing in. Then, using a tape measure, check the circumference of the ball to ensure it meets the requirements. Additionally, weigh the ball to make sure it’s not too heavy or too light. Taking these steps will help guarantee that your new soccer ball is up to par for your next game.

Is there a difference between soccer balls? ›

Turf soccer balls are made to withstand more wear and tear from artificial fields that tend to have a rougher playing surface. Indoor soccer balls are most often size 5, but are made to have less rebound to accommodate the harder surfaces and turf that covers the playing ground and walls of an indoor soccer field.
